What You Need to Know About the First WSBK Race of the Season!

Last year, Jonathan Rea took his second WSBK championship while riding the factory Kawasaki. His nearest competitor was Chaz Davies of Wales, but with many changes rolling into the paddock, could either of them expect to fight for the title again?

This year, Honda has returned to the grid with a highly redesigned CBR1000RR. It is piloted by former MotoGP champ Nicky Hayden—the Kentucky Kid! Meanwhile, former WSBK race winner—and near champion—Macro Melandri rejoined the series on a Ducati Panigale.

If that wasn’t enough, Yamaha is searching for a championship on its new YZF-R1 platform, and British Superbike champ Alex Lowes is raring to deliver that win. Of course, Tom Sykes is also itching for his own shot at the championship since he hasn’t won one since Rea joined the Kawasaki team.
